Safety Tips

A biofuel fire is the same design as an open gas fireplace or wood stove however, it utilizes plant-based energy instead of fossil fuel. The result is an energy source that is green and clean and does not release harmful gases into the atmosphere.

While these fires don't require a flue or chimney however, they are extremely dangerous and should not be left unattended. The same safety rules applicable to other types of flammable fuels apply to these flames and include keeping them away from combustible materials and following instructions from the manufacturer when refilling or using the burner.

These guidelines will be laid out in the owner's manual included with every model of bioethanol fire. Be sure to read the instructions and safety warnings. It is also important to maintain the distance between you and the burning bioethanol flame and ensure that children and pets are kept away from the fire also. If you plan to hang any kind of artwork or decoration above the fireplace made of bioethanol, you should leave a minimum of 60 cm distance between the flame effect and the surface of the wall.

Use a funnel when filling your bioethanol fireplace in order to avoid spills. Before refilling, make sure that the stainless steel burner and all other components are empty and completely dry. If there is any spillage during refilling, clean it up immediately and allow the burner to cool down completely before relighting it.

Bioethanol fireplaces burn clean and emit only steam and water vapours and carbon dioxide when they are operating. It is important to ensure that the room is adequately ventilated while the fire is burning. This can be done by opening a window to a certain extent and not blocking any existing air vents in the room.

Bioethanol's combustion process is very simple. However the fuel is highly flammable. It could cause serious injuries if it is spilled onto clothing or any other combustible material. Wear rubber gloves when you work with the fuel. Be careful to avoid spilling any on your skin or around other items that could catch a fire.

Refueling a bio-fireplace

With a bio ethanol fire it is easy to control the flame intensity. Close the flame using the device included with your fireplace. When you are ready to relight your fire, open the shutter and add the fuel until it reaches the max line, but be sure not to overfill. You can expect 3.5 to 4 hours of burning from 1 Liter of fuel. It is recommended to keep a stock of bioethanol so that you can replenish the burner when required.
